DIED. Darryl Zanuck, 77, imperious production chief at 20th Century-Fox for 35 years and a thousand films; of pneumonia; in Palm Springs, Calif. The cigar-chomping, polo-playing mogul got his Hollywood break when Warner Bros, hired him as a $250-a-week scenarist for Rin Tin Tin. In four years he was head of production at 20 times that salary. Warner's Wunderkind brought dialogue to feature films (The Jazz Singer, 1927) and pioneered such realistic genres as the gangster and "working gal" films. In 1933 Zanuck and United Artists Head Joseph M. Schenck formed 20th Century...
